Output 43dcaa65637023c7a54681d8cfc421e48d77953c8ae75df2dfee64f366306d06:0

value
32743
script pubkey
OP_0 OP_PUSHBYTES_20 880a23a160177be8bffa1155db045ac5ccb45c63
address
bc1q3q9z8gtqzaa730l6z92akpz6chxtghrrkwexl6
transaction
43dcaa65637023c7a54681d8cfc421e48d77953c8ae75df2dfee64f366306d06
confirmations
18532
spent
true